Quoting: ThunderbirdDoom works fine in Vulkan mode on Wine 3.4.

The way Vulkan I implemented Vulkan is different from wine-staging.

The functionality is within what Vulkan calls an 'ICD', which is winevulkan.dll.

You need to install the Windows vulkan loader vulkan-1.dll to use winevulkan.

See full instructions on my github: https://github.com/roderickc/wine-vulkan [External Link].

We are working on making this all easier in newer versions.

Sveinar Søpler 2018-02-16 09:41:49 CST

There are enourmous amounts of changes from 2.x -> 3.x, so rebasing wine staging from last-known 2.21 -> 3.1 is a huge undertaking.

If staging should have stayed "alive" in its previous form, this would have been needed to be rebased each git-master i guess, cos the changes from 2.21 -> 3.1 (current dev) is very large.

Its a real shame that none from winehq-dev spits out any public message, cos what is going on now is that there will be 2-3-4+ ppl/groups all doing their own rebases.. possibly to varying degrees.

The documentation on the staging repository is there.. in the history of commits, so if it would be of use, one should cherry pick "important" patches, and get those in. Doing the whole patch-set is... well.. too daunting imo.

Kudos to everyone lending a hand tho! :)

Comment 12 Henri Verbeet 2018-02-16 10:20:46 CST

If it's any consolation, the Staging people haven't told us anything either. Clearly that's not ideal.

I'd suggest people interested in picking up the Staging patches coordinate on the wine-devel mailing list and the #winehackers IRC channel, but ultimately that's of course up to individual people.

Comment 13 Luke Short 2018-02-16 17:50:50 CST

It was expressed a few months ago at WineConf 2017 that, moving forward, the idea is to work on cleaning up the hacky patches from Wine-Staging and get them into the official Wine project faster.

If you keep track of the wine-devel mailing list you will already notice that a lot of patches have already been cleaned up and integrated.

With the Wine 3.0 release, Alexandre even gave the greenlight to integrate the long-awaited command stream multi-threading (CSMT) patches.

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=AokFgDSLMWU [External Link]

Comment 14 Zebediah Figura 2018-02-16 18:36:12 CST

The suggestion was made, and some people (mostly Vincent, more recently also Alistair among others) have been trying to do so.

That said, none of the Staging people attended the last conference (and indeed they've been radio-silent since early November, before the conference began), so it's not really the case that the agreed-upon intent is now to get rid of Staging.
